What does DNA provide the code for?

Biology
2 answers:
GaryK [48]4 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Protein Synthesis

Explanation:

The DNA provides the code to form messenger RNA. Messenger RNA attaches to ribosome. Transfer RNA attaches to messenger RNA, Protein chain continued until reaches 3 letter code.

Which of these cells of the dermal tissue of plants prevent water loss and control gas exchange?
masha68 [24]
The answer is guard cells. 
Guard cells are cells surrounding each stoma. They help regulate the rate of transpiration by opening and closing the stomata. They are specialized cells in the epidermis of leaves, stems and other organs that are used to control gas exchange. They are produced in pairs with a gap between them that forms a stomatal pore (stoma).
